EFFICACY OF A PHYSICAL ACTIVITY COACHING SYSTEM FOR PATIENTS WITH COPD (Effectiviteitsonderzoek naar een coachingsprogramma voor het behouden van fysieke activiteit in patienten met COPD)

Completed
Conditions
COPD patients (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ease)
Physical activity
coaching
pulmonary rehabilitation
Registration Number
NL-OMON28407
Lead Sponsor
Philips Research and CIRO+ expertise center, the Netherlands

Target Recruitment
90
Inclusion Criteria

•Age > 45 years;

•Clinical diagnosis of COPD according to Global Initiative for Chronic Obstructive Lung Disease (GOLD)1 referred for pulmonary rehabilitation;

Exclusion Criteria

•Subjects who do not meet the above mentioned inclusion criteria

•Subjects who are not primarily diagnosed with COPD

Primary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
-Physical activity<br /><br>-Psycho-social factors by several questionnaires (e.g., anxiety, depression, self efficacy, responses to physical activity, motivation, personality, mood, clinical control variables). <br /><br>-possible other explanatory factors for differences in physical activity, such as commonly used transport, having a dog, home settings (how do you live?), and exacerbation history.
Secondary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
-Evaluate the acceptance and usability of COPD patients to use an electronic physical activity coaching program at home by a short interview and google analytics
